1994 Chevrolet Impala vs. 2004 Citroen Xsara
To start off, 2004 Citroen Xsara is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1994 Chevrolet Impala.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1994 Chevrolet Impala would be higher. At 6,276 cc (8 cylinders), 1994 Chevrolet Impala is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1994 Chevrolet Impala weights approximately 502 kg more than 2004 Citroen Xsara.
Let's talk about torque, 1994 Chevrolet Impala (633 Nm) has 378 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Citroen Xsara. (255 Nm). This means 1994 Chevrolet Impala will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Citroen Xsara. 1994 Chevrolet Impala has automatic transmission and 2004 Citroen Xsara has manual transmission. 2004 Citroen Xsara will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1994 Chevrolet Impala will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
